BD Horizon RealYellow™ 655 (RY655) Reagents leverage an innovative laser-specific fluorochrome, excited primarily by the 561-nm yellow-green laser to offer:
| Format | Ex Max | Em Max | Spectral | Conventional | Relative Brightness | Spillover* (1 = low, 4 = high) | Alternative To |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| RY655 | 557 nm | 654 nm | ✓ | ✓ | 3 | PE-Cy5, StarBright™ Yellow 665 |

BD Horizon™ RY655 Reagents show stable performance with lot-to-lot consistency across made-to-stock reagents and BD OptiBuild™ On-Demand Reagents. Human whole blood was stained with human CD3 (UCHT1, left) or CD4 (SK3, right) RY655 using three different dye lots, followed by lysis with BD Pharm Lyse™ Lysing Buffer. All samples were acquired on a Cytek™ Aurora Spectral Analyzer. CD3 and CD4 were tested in separate experiments.

Buffer Compatibility
| Buffers | Results |
| BD FACS™ Lysing Solution and BD Pharm Lyse™ Lysing Buffer | Compatible |
| BD Cytofix™ Fixation Buffer | Stable at least 24 hours |
| 1% PFA | Stable at least 24 hours |
| BD Cytofix/Cytoperm™ Fixation and Permeabilization Solution | Compatible with antibody staining before and after fixation |
| BD FACS™ Permeabilizing Solution 2 | Compatible with antibody staining before and after fixation |
| BD Phosflow™ Perm Buffer III | Compatible with antibody staining before and after fixation |
| EDTA and Heparin | Compatible |
| BD Horizon™ Brilliant Stain Buffer (BSB) | Compatible |
